I would like to introduce Lisa Stout to you. Here is what Lisa wrote:



"My relationship with Stampin’ Up! started shortly after I got married 8 years ago. I have always been crafty making gifts, quilts, scrapbooks and sewing; but I had never stamped. I went to a workshop at my dear friend’s house and haven’t stopped stamping since.



Before my son was born, just over five years ago I stop working. My husband and I decided that we wanted me to stay home with our son. With just one income, my crafting habits started to dip into our monthly budget. I finally decided that being a demonstrator might be a good thing for me and my family. It’s been a little over two years now and I’ve loved every minute of it and my husband loves that my crafting supplies are a tax right off.



At that time, the demonstrator I was using lived fifty miles away and had become unreliable. So I searched for a demonstrator close to home. I found one and she assured me she was reliable, NOT! After my starter kit arrived(during the first week of Sell-A-Bration, back when it was Sell and not Sale) she contacted me just a few times. To this day I have only seen her once.



I was desperately seeking other demonstrators to share with and learn from. Last year I found Max, or rather she found me, in another online demo group that we joined. She invited me to join UDI and assured me I would get support, friends, and hugs. She was right. I am overwhelmed sometimes at how generous and giving the DIVAS can be. Whether you need a hug or a kick in the pants, one of the DIVAS will step up. I am so grateful I have found my adopted upline and some wonderful friends. "
